I get the best that I can. Nothing is worse than packing junk up a hill and not having it work. If it is serviceable and reliable then your just looking at trades off such as ease or weight. Weight usually wins out in the end if its a tie. One thing, don't skimp on Glass like your Binocs, scope or spotting scope. Scrimp, save, sell other guns, but get the best glass that's out there. I prefer Leupold, it’s never ever let me down and the warranty is great but to each their own.

I pick up quite a bit of stuff on Craigslist. There was a brand new sleeping pad for sale for $20 the other day that is $90 at REI. Today I picked up a tripod for $15 that is $46 at Amazon.com. So you can find some deals here, put in a want ad.
Also, after I get back I take inventory and if there is anything that I didn't use I consider leaving it home next time. After awhile you won't have to do this, you will just "know" but when I go out with other people it amazes me some of the things that they think they need.

I'm not much of a backpack hunter anymore as I am over 70 now:cool:. But I do a lot of hiking when I hunt. I use a small daypack (brand don't really matter IMHO, just so its comfortable and will hold what you take). I also use a surplus GI web belt & canteen with the issue suspenders. Been using it for years and I really like it. Got rid of 2 pieces of optics (binos & rangefinder) and replaced it with one...a Sworo combo. It has really been great for the last 2 years and makes a lot of sense as I am a rifle hunter and don't need the special RF made for bow hunters. I carry a number of safety items...a few light sticks, floro red tape, SPOT,small butane cig lighter, spare pair of sox, rain gear, rope, space blanket, spare set of contact lenses and Rx glasses and some energy bars. Notice I left out a compass...my watch has one builtin. I also carry one of the new Bushnell GPS return instruments (can't remember the name right now) which really is simple and helps you navigate back to anywhere you set into it) Pretty cheap too@ around $50.
Thats about it for safety stuff. I also carry a small folding saw, knife sharpener and a spare larger knife. Everything alltogether probably weighs less than 20#.
